4 Biomass Energy in Cambodia Cambodia has significant biomass energy resources including rice husks. Exports of milled rice is expected to increase from 0.2 million tons in 2012 to 1 million tons by 2015 (A 400% increase in 3 years). At the same time, electricity tariffs are high and only 50% of Cambodians have access to power. Rural electrification is even lower, at less than 30%. Rice husk biomass energy will exploit Cambodia s skyrocketing rice production to electrify rural areas. 4

6 Biomass Power Generation Technology Existing solutions Gasifier + Hybrid Diesel Engine SOMA Energy s solution: 100% loose rice husk gasifier & genset Advantages of the new solution loose rice husk: eliminates the need for extra energy inputs through pelletising and gasification 100% diesel free: further reducing power generation costs required by users Byproduct: ash and bio-char, can be used as soil enhancer, potential to generate additional income for users and provide value to Cambodian agriculture Lower carbon emission: generally more environmentally friendly and provides potential opportunities in carbon offsets and credits 6

GE-Waukesha VHP 5904 The gasification process converts the feedstock, such as rice husks, into Producer Gas, ready to feed into the power generator The retooled GE Waukesha gas engine is compatible with 100% synthetic gas produced from biomass gasification for power generation If fully developed, the biomass gasification technology in Cambodia using rice husks has great potential to address the country s energy security. 7

11 Biomass Energy in Cambodia Biomass Energy Generation Challenges : Supply chain management Secure supply and transportation of rice husks Price volatility of feedstock Lack of renewable energy policy and incentives for producers Limited access to financing Expanding national electricity grid High transportation cost relative to the value of commodity Policy environment and feedstock management are the main challenges facing Cambodia s biomass energy industry 11

15 Comparison of 3 Options Option #3 of building and operating silos presents the best rate of return among the three business models, but also requires the largest initial capital investment. Options #2 can be considered in areas rich in paddy but lacking in power, as well as alongside Option #3. Option #1 is suitable for regions with relatively higher concentration of existing mills.
